    Service Corporation International is an American provider of funeral goods and services as well as cemetery property and services. It is headquartered in Neartown, Houston, Texas, and operates secondary corporate offices in Jefferson, Louisiana (near New Orleans). [5] [6] SCI operates more than 1500 funeral homes and 400 cemeteries. [1]

    It is a Catholic cemetery run by the Roman Catholic Diocese of Oakland, which also operates the Holy Angels Funeral and Cremation Center at the same location. [1] It was the first Catholic Church-owned funeral home in the U.S. [2] The cemetery planted 3 acres of vineyards to provide grapes for sacramental wine used by the Oakland Diocese. [2]

    Thomas Saltus Lubbock (November 29, 1817 – January 9, 1862) [1] was a figure in Texas and the Confederacy. Born in South Carolina, he relocated to Texas and became a Texas Ranger, fighting in the Texas Revolution. Lubbock later served as a lieutenant in the failed Texan Santa Fe Expedition.
